A Window into the Past: The Observatory’s Capabilities

Nestled atop Cerro Pachon, the observatory’s location provides optimal conditions for observing the heavens. The dry air and dark skies are crucial for capturing the faintest light signals from distant galaxies and celestial objects. Early images have already stunned, offering unprecedented detail of star-forming regions and galaxies.

Consider the image capturing the Trifid Nebula and the Lagoon Nebula, thousands of light-years away. The Rubin Observatory captured this image with incredible clarity, highlighting features previously unseen. Imagine the possibilities!

The Legacy Survey of Space and Time (LSST): A Decade of Discovery

Later this year, the observatory will commence its flagship project, the Legacy Survey of Space and Time (LSST). This ambitious undertaking will scan the night sky every night for a decade, capturing even the subtlest changes with unparalleled precision. This continuous monitoring will allow astronomers to track celestial movements and detect unexpected cosmic events.

Did you know? The LSST is expected to generate more data than any previous astronomical survey, requiring advanced data-processing systems to analyze the vast amounts of information.

Hunting for Dark Matter and Dark Energy: Unraveling Cosmic Mysteries

The Vera Rubin Observatory is named after pioneering American astronomer Vera C. Rubin, who provided the first conclusive evidence for the existence of dark matter. One of the observatory’s primary goals is to understand the nature of dark matter and dark energy, which collectively make up approximately 95% of the universe. Discovering the secrets of dark matter and dark energy may change our understanding of physics.

Tracking Asteroids and Interstellar Objects: Protecting Our Planet

Beyond its cosmological studies, the observatory is also a powerful tool for tracking asteroids and interstellar objects. In initial observations, it discovered thousands of previously unseen asteroids in our solar system, including several near-Earth objects. This capability is critical for planetary defense.
